Can I use any pots and pans on an induction hob?
No, induction hobs require ferrous pots and pans (i.e., magnetic) to function. This implies stainless-steel and cast iron work, while glass and aluminum pots may not.

4. Are convection ovens much better than standard ovens?
It depends upon personal choice. Convection ovens provide faster and more even cooking however may not be ideal for all baking recipes, particularly those requiring particular temperatures.
5. What is the average lifespan of a cooking hob and oven?
With appropriate care, both hobs and ovens can last anywhere from 10 to 20 years, depending on frequency of use and upkeep.
